In plain English

This site isn't currently accessible β€” it returns a 404 error. While it's a subdomain of lexis.com, a trusted legal brand, the lack of any working page, contact info, or legal documents means there's nothing to trust right now. If you were expecting a service here, it's likely a broken link or a test environment, not a live website you should use.

Where the score comes from

We look at six areas. Here's how ukapi-plus.lexis.com did in each.
50
Security

The site has a valid SSL certificate and uses modern encryption, but it returns a 404 error, meaning the server isn't serving any content. That's a red flag for availability, even if the connection itself is secure.

40
Identity

This is a subdomain of lexis.com, which is a well-known legal research company. However, we have no direct WHOIS details for this specific subdomain, and the site itself doesn't reveal who runs it.

30
Reputation

No blacklists, but there's no history on the Wayback Machine and no external reviews. The site isn't ranked or mentioned anywhere, which is expected for a subdomain that may be new or abandoned.

20
Transparency

The site has no contact information, no about page, and no social media links. For any kind of business, that's a serious gap. Even a test page usually has some way to reach the owner.

20
Compliance

No privacy policy or terms of service are present. For a legal services subdomain, that's a major omission, but the site is not active, so it may not be a commercial offering yet.

40
Infrastructure

Hosted on Amazon Web Services with good DNS resolution, but it lacks email servers, security headers, and DNSSEC. The server is Kestrel, which is a .NET web server, common for internal apps.

ukapi-plus.lexis.com is a subdomain of the well-known legal research company LexisNexis, but the page itself is not working. It returns a 404 error, meaning the server has no content to show. That could mean it's a development spot, a deleted page, or a misconfigured internal tool. Even for a test site, you'd expect some kind of placeholder or contact information. There are no privacy policies, terms of service, or company details. If you arrived here expecting a live API or dashboard, treat it as a broken link. Don't enter any personal data or attempt to log in. Most legitimate legal tech services have clear documentation and support channels. The lack of a working page and the absence of any transparent ownership signals make this site untrustworthy as a functional resource. For a true LexisNexis service, you should access it through the main lexis.com domain or a verified subdomain that is actively maintained.
